Critical Acclaim“The storytelling is brisk, conversational, and polished… readers who enjoy probing, encouraging tales of Zen discovery will find much here that heartens, challenges, and inspires growth. Inspiring stories of connection, quiet strength, and facing conflict with Zen presence.” — Publishers Weekly“An enlightening book about conflict… The writing is spare yet evocative, philosophical yet accessible.” — Kirkus ReviewsConflict isn’t the enemy.Most of us meet conflict with control, avoidance, or quick fixes.Conflict and Zen: Stories of Presence in Heated Moments offers another way—one rooted in Zen, mindfulness, and the quiet strength of deep listening.At its heart, this book asks a radical question:What if the problem is not conflict itself, but how we meet it?A Fresh Approach to Conflict, Mindfulness, and CommunicationIn a marketplace filled with books on negotiation, communication, and conflict management, Conflict and Zen stands apart.It doesn’t offer formulas or scripts. Instead, it draws from Zen practice, meditation, and real human encounters—inviting readers to pause and face difficulty with clarity.Through forty-five short stories set in courtyards, kitchens, train platforms, and hospital rooms, the book reveals how conflict can become:A doorway to deeper connectionA spark for personal transformationA call to be fully present, even in heated momentsWhat You’ll Find InsideEach story illuminates how mindfulness and compassion can shift even the most difficult interactions. Drawing on decades of experience in conflict resolution and contemplative practice, the author shows that conflict is not simply a crisis to manage—it is a mirror reflecting our habits and assumptions.The path forward isn’t about fixing problems but transforming how we see them.Conflict and Zen is more than a book—it is an invitation to meet life as it unfolds, with openness, courage, and calm presence.
